Gutters and downspouts play a vital role in directing water away from your house. Clogged or damaged gutters can overflow and lead to water pooling close to your basis. This not only contributes to structural damage however also can create favorable situations for mold growth. Cleaning gutters regularly, especially after heavy storms, is probably considered one of the simplest yet most effective preventative measures to keep away from future water damage.


Proper grading round your property is important. Yard slopes should direct water away from your home’s foundation. If the bottom close to your basis is uneven or sloping towards the construction, moisture can seep into your decrease ranges. Re-grading the landscape can help resolve this problem, making it a worthwhile funding for long-term safety.

Another essential area to watch is the interior plumbing system. Leaky faucets, toilets, or burst pipes could cause important water damage over time. Regular plumbing inspections can catch minor leaks before they turn out to be main issues. Simple practices corresponding to turning off the water supply when going on vacation can even prevent from potential disasters.


Basements are often particularly prone to water damage. Installing sump pumps may help handle water ranges successfully. These devices routinely pump out excess water that accumulates within the basement, mitigating the risk of flooding. Regularly testing the sump pump for performance should also be part of your upkeep routine.


Humidity ranges should not be missed when contemplating preventative measures to keep away from future water damage. High indoor humidity can encourage mold progress and deteriorate structural parts. Using dehumidifiers in damp areas like basements might help maintain a snug humidity stage, thus protecting your belongings and home.

Sealing cracks and gaps in walls, windows, and doors can prevent the intrusion of water during heavy rainfall. Over time, materials settle and put on down, resulting in small fissures that may go unnoticed but can enable moisture to enter. Using caulking or weather-stripping around home windows and doors is an effective and simple preventative measure.


Using waterproof supplies, particularly in areas vulnerable to moisture like bathrooms and kitchens, is one other strategic approach to prevent water damage. Opting for water-resistant drywall, tiles, or specialised paint can create a resilient barrier against leaks and spills. Investing in these supplies initially can prevent from intensive repairs down the line.


Another aspect to monitor is the situation of the roof. Regular roof inspections can establish small leaks or vulnerabilities that could lead to substantial water damage. Shingles might become cracked or worn over time, requiring replacement or remedy. Ensuring that flashing round chimneys and vents is intact can also keep your house dry during storms.

  • Regularly inspect and maintain your roof to determine and repair leaks or damaged shingles earlier than they cause water intrusion.

  • Install and routinely clear gutter techniques to make sure proper drainage and prevent overflow that may lead to basis damage.

  • Seal and caulk home windows and doorways to prevent moisture seepage, notably in high-rainfall areas.

  • Use water resistant supplies in basements and lower levels, like moisture-resistant paints and vinyl-based flooring, to mitigate damage risks.

  • Monitor indoor humidity levels with a hygrometer, aiming for a range of 30-50% to scale back mold and mildew development.

  • Install sump pumps in basements prone to flooding, and ensure they have a battery backup for energy outages.

  • Regularly verify and keep plumbing techniques, including pipes and fixtures, to catch leaks earlier than they escalate.

  • Create a complete drainage plan round your property to direct rainwater away from the muse and stop pooling.

  • Educate relations on shutting off the main water provide in case of emergencies to restrict damage from sudden leaks.

  • Inspect home equipment that use water, such as washers and refrigerators, periodically to stop leaks and handle wear and tear.
